About Pisek

Pisek is a ghost town in northern Colorado County, Texas. Once a small community, it was gradually left behind after 1941 as residents relocated to nearby Lone Oak along Farm to Market Road 1291. The old townsite sits along a railroad corridor running between Fayetteville in Fayette County and New Ulm in Austin County.

Visitors today will find little more than the quiet rural landscape and the remnants of a place that simply faded away. There are no documented structures or formal attractions on site, making this a destination primarily for those with an interest in Texas history and the stories of small communities that once dotted the state's countryside.
